Billy Fowler

1932 ∼ 2013

Billy Fowler Sr., 80, of Kountze, died Sunday August 11, 2013 at his home. He was a native of Carthage, he lived in Kountze and was a retired sheet metal worker. He is preceded in death by his wife, Mary E. Parker Fowler. He is survived by his sister, Audie L. Anderson and husband Peewee of Kountze; children, Billy Fowler Jr. of Houston, Patricia A. Fowler of Kountze, James E. Fowler of Houston, Richard E. Fowler of Kountze and Oscar W. Fowler of Beaumont; 14 grandchildren; 15 great grandchildren. His family will receive friends Tuesday August 13, 2013 from 5:00 p.m. until 8:00 p.m. at Faith and Family Funeral Services Chapel. A service of remembrance is scheduled for Thursday 3:00 p.m. at Faith and Family Funeral Services Chapel, officiated by Reverend A. A. Calloway and Reverend Ernest Brown. Interment will follow at Old Hardin Cemetery in Kountze. Serving as pallbearers will be Richard Fowler, Rodney Anderson, Terry Anderson, John Hayes, Randy Stuts and Don Moye.
